#ifndef BOOST_ARCHIVE_ITERATORS_ESCAPE_HPP |
|
#define BOOST_ARCHIVE_ITERATORS_ESCAPE_HPP |
|
|
|
// MS compatible compilers support #pragma once |
|
#if defined(_MSC_VER) && (_MSC_VER >= 1020) |
|
# pragma once |
|
#endif |
|
|
|
/////////1/////////2/////////3/////////4/////////5/////////6/////////7/////////8 |
|
// escape.hpp |
|
|
|
// (C) Copyright 2002 Robert Ramey - http://www.rrsd.com . |
|
// Use, modification and distribution is subject to the Boost Software |
|
// License, Version 1.0. (See accompanying file LICENSE_1_0.txt or copy at |
|
// http://www.boost.org/LICENSE_1_0.txt) |
|
|
|
// See http://www.boost.org for updates, documentation, and revision history. |
|
|
|
#include <boost/assert.hpp> |
|
#include <cstddef> // NULL |
|
|
|
#include <boost/config.hpp> // for BOOST_DEDUCED_TYPENAME |
|
#include <boost/iterator/iterator_adaptor.hpp> |
|
#include <boost/iterator/iterator_traits.hpp> |
|
|
|
namespace boost { |
|
namespace archive { |
|
namespace iterators { |
|
|
|
/////////1/////////2/////////3/////////4/////////5/////////6/////////7/////////8 |
|
// insert escapes into text |
|
|
|
template<class Derived, class Base> |
|
class escape : |
|
public boost::iterator_adaptor< |
|
Derived, |
|
Base, |
|
BOOST_DEDUCED_TYPENAME boost::iterator_value<Base>::type, |
|
single_pass_traversal_tag, |
|
BOOST_DEDUCED_TYPENAME boost::iterator_value<Base>::type |
|
> |
|
{ |
|
typedef BOOST_DEDUCED_TYPENAME boost::iterator_value<Base>::type base_value_type; |
|
typedef BOOST_DEDUCED_TYPENAME boost::iterator_reference<Base>::type reference_type; |
|
friend class boost::iterator_core_access; |
|
|
|
typedef BOOST_DEDUCED_TYPENAME boost::iterator_adaptor< |
|
Derived, |
|
Base, |
|
base_value_type, |
|
single_pass_traversal_tag, |
|
base_value_type |
|
> super_t; |
|
|
|
typedef escape<Derived, Base> this_t; |
|
|
|
void dereference_impl() { |
|
m_current_value = static_cast<Derived *>(this)->fill(m_bnext, m_bend); |
|
m_full = true; |
|
} |
|
|
|
//Access the value referred to |
|
reference_type dereference() const { |
|
if(!m_full) |
|
const_cast<this_t *>(this)->dereference_impl(); |
|
return m_current_value; |
|
} |
|
|
|
bool equal(const this_t & rhs) const { |
|
if(m_full){ |
|
if(! rhs.m_full) |
|
const_cast<this_t *>(& rhs)->dereference_impl(); |
|
} |
|
else{ |
|
if(rhs.m_full) |
|
const_cast<this_t *>(this)->dereference_impl(); |
|
} |
|
if(m_bnext != rhs.m_bnext) |
|
return false; |
|
if(this->base_reference() != rhs.base_reference()) |
|
return false; |
|
return true; |
|
} |
|
|
|
void increment(){ |
|
if(++m_bnext < m_bend){ |
|
m_current_value = *m_bnext; |
|
return; |
|
} |
|
++(this->base_reference()); |
|
m_bnext = NULL; |
|
m_bend = NULL; |
|
m_full = false; |
|
} |
|
|
|
// buffer to handle pending characters |
|
const base_value_type *m_bnext; |
|
const base_value_type *m_bend; |
|
bool m_full; |
|
base_value_type m_current_value; |
|
public: |
|
escape(Base base) : |
|
super_t(base), |
|
m_bnext(NULL), |
|
m_bend(NULL), |
|
m_full(false) |
|
{ |
|
} |
|
}; |
|
|
|
} // namespace iterators |
|
} // namespace archive |
|
} // namespace boost |
|
|
|
#endif // BOOST_ARCHIVE_ITERATORS_ESCAPE_HPP
